The Rise of Mobile Gaming
The surge of mobile gaming can be attributed to several factors:
- **Accessibility** - With smartphones more affordable than ever, a wider audience can access gaming.

- **Social Engagement** - Multiplayer options allow for social interactions, making gaming a communal activity.

Mobile Games vs. Traditional Gaming
Aspect | Mobile Games | Traditional Gaming |
---|---|---|
**Cost** | Often free or low-cost with in-app purchases | Higher upfront costs for consoles/computers and games |
**Convenience** | Playable anywhere, anytime | Often requires a dedicated gaming space |
**Content Variety** | Wide range of genres and styles | May focus more on AAA titles |
This table highlights significant differences between mobile games and traditional gaming. While both have their unique advantages, mobile games cater to a broader audience, especially those seeking quick and easy entertainment wherever they are.
Industry Implications
The impact of mobile gaming isn’t limited to just individual users. The games industry as a whole has experienced a seismic shift. Popular franchises are now focusing on mobile adaptations to capture this growing market. Also, the disruption caused by mobile games has forced traditional gaming companies to reevaluate their strategies.
- **Investing in Mobile Platforms** - Major developers are creating exclusive mobile titles.
- **Collaborative Projects** - Budding partnerships between mobile developers and larger gaming companies are becoming common.
- **E-sports Growth** - Mobile gaming tournaments are emerging, attracting audiences and sponsorships.
